Joomla 3.3.xにアップグレードしたいJoomla 2.5.28サイトがあります。
利用可能なすべてのドキュメントでは、アップデートサーバーを短期間に設定するだけで、3.xシリーズのアップグレードオプションが表示されます。まあ、それはしません!キャッシュをクリアしたり、ログアウトして再度ログインしたりしました。コントロールパネルには、Joomla 2.5が間もなくサポートされなくなるという通知が表示されますが、Joomlaアップデートビューには、
あなたはすでに最新のJoomlaを持っています!バージョン、2.5.28。
移行を開始するオプションがありません。
何か案は?
私もずっと前にこの問題を抱えていました。使用可能なすべてのキャッシュをクリアしてパージし、再試行してみました。更新パッケージをダウンロードする別の方法があります。
Joomla_3.3.6-Stable-Update_Package.Zip
完了したら、JoomlaバックエンドのExtension Managerを介して他の拡張機能と同じようにインストールします。何かを行う前に、2.5サイト(データベースを含む)のバックアップを取ることを忘れないでください。
お役に立てれば
これを試して:
それによって3.3.Xアップデートが表示されるかどうかを確認します。
私はそれが安全策であると信じているので、最初にそれについて考えずに誤ってサイトを3.xにぶつけないでください。
ブライアンピートによって説明されている手順が機能するはずです。同じ問題があったが、サイトはすでに最高のバージョン2.5.xであると言っていた。アップグレードテストのために、サイトのコピーでこの問題に遭遇しました。コピーサイトでは、最新バージョンの2.5に更新できました。更新後、私は短期サポートに切り替え、サイトはそれが最高レベルであると言い続けました。元のサイトをもう一度確認すると、最新バージョンの2.5に更新できました。ただし、更新を再度確認した後(単に[更新を検索]ボタンをもう一度クリックしただけ)、サイトはそれが最高レベルであると述べました。長期と短期間の切り替えは違いがありませんでした。したがって、どこかに問題があるはずです。何らかの理由で、Joomla Coreアップデートのエントリが#__updatesテーブルから消えていることがわかりました。これを修正するには、次のようにします。
3.xへのアップデートが存在する必要があります。
Joomlaのキャッシュを削除すると、この問題は常に解決されたように見えましたが、Extensions-> Extension Manager-> Updateでもキャッシュを削除する必要がありました。
更新キャッシュがクリアされると、2.5.28から3.5.1へのJoomla更新が提供されました。
PHPを5.6以上に設定してみてください
私のために働いた。
Php5.4ではアップデートが表示されませんでしたが、変更するとすぐに表示されました。